I made a bow tuck for my aunt to use as a beach bag. (She and my sister own the family cottage on Lake Erie, and they'll be opening it for the season over Memorial Day weekend.) I had some fabric left, so I made an insulated water bottle carrier. I still had some left after that, so I used the rest of it to make a sunglasses pouch, a kleenex pouch and a nifty triangular stuff pouch. Oh, and a keychain strap that didn't manage to make the picture for some reason. Now all I've got left are scraps!

The bottom is fabric spray-adhesived to a piece of election sign (the wire frame is propping up my peonies), and the button is a piece of shell with button holes drilled in it.
